As nouns, restrainer is a hyponym of chemical; that is, restrainer is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than chemical:
  • chemical: material produced by or used in a reaction involving changes in atoms or molecules
  • restrainer: a chemical that is added to a photographic developer in order to retard development and reduce the amount of fog on a film
